So without further ado we turn our attention the the Adventures included with this calendar.
A year on Gosfel is a series of 12 5E adventures, starting at level 1 and moving through to level 5. We have designed these so that they can be played as a campaign across the whole year, as individual one shot adventures or even as encounters in your existing homebrew game.
The island of Gosfel is rather hard to reach, with airship the preferred method due to the island only being accessible by sea for one night a year, the rest of the time the only access channel is blocked by an aggressive giant turtle. (A long story which slowly reveals itself).
The year starts rather dramatically with an airship crash, and once the Characters salvage what they can and reach what passes for civilisation on this remote island they quickly realise dark forces are acting against them. In their capacity as Wardens of the island, with a tenure of one year, the Characters are called upon to remove threats, investigate disappearances and battle a whole host of foes.
But they are never far from treachery as the Island's dark history quickly proves far more than folklore and superstition, and the reality of living under the flipper of an enormous indifferent and occasionally murderous Testudine sinks in horrifyingly quickly.
So now the Characters must battle a dark foe, avoid upsetting a turtle and watch over the islanders as they endure a year on Gosfel.
What could possible go wrong?
Each month's adventure has notes and guides on adjusting for stronger or weaker party members, and guides on how to run it as a stand alone one shot, as part of a home brew campaign or as a linked adventure in our Year on Gosfel campaign.
We also (as always) have sections on how to use the map environs to enhance the encounters you run using the maps.
So whether you're running the campaign monthly, or just after plots, encounters and Characters for your homebrew, there is a huge amount of content here for everyone!
